I've been poking around the archives to see if I could find where this topic has been covered, to no avail, so I'm going to look to the kind folks of CPF for help:

I finally got around to testing the current flow on my 3D M@glight/DD/TWAK mod and was shocked to see 480mA with fresh Energizer D cells. Hooked the DMM in series, downstream of the LED. What am I doing wrong, people?

Is your DMM set to the 10A (or so) setting? On fresh cells, you should be seeing over an amp. On a DD setup, the easiest way to measure the current is to just remove the tailcap and close the connection with the probes of the DMM.
